About Ilse Smets

Ilse Smets is a scholar working on Pollution, Water Science and Technology, Molecular Biology, Industrial and Manufacturing Engineering and Control and Systems Engineering, having authored 130 papers that have together received 2.1k indexed citations. Recurring topics across this work include Wastewater Treatment and Nitrogen Removal (44 papers), Membrane Separation Technologies (25 papers), Advanced Control Systems Optimization (19 papers), Constructed Wetlands for Wastewater Treatment (15 papers), Coagulation and Flocculation Studies (10 papers), Membrane-based Ion Separation Techniques (10 papers), Microbial Metabolic Engineering and Bioproduction (9 papers) and Wastewater Treatment and Reuse (7 papers). The work is most often cited by research in Pollution (604 citations), Water Science and Technology (700 citations), Industrial and Manufacturing Engineering (402 citations), Building and Construction (221 citations) and Control and Systems Engineering (355 citations). Ilse Smets has collaborated with scholars based in Belgium, United States and France. Frequent co-authors include Jan Van Impe, Raf Dewil, Marcel Ameloot, R. Jenné, E. N. Banadda, Rob Van den Broeck, Lutgarde Raskin, Bart Peeters, Steven J. Skerlos and Paul Steels. Their work appears in journals such as Water Science & Technology, Journal of Process Control, Separation and Purification Technology, Journal of Membrane Science and Water Research.
